## Cron Drift Investigation — Pellmont Scheduler

Summary for the weekly sync: nightly jobs on Pellmont drifted up to 14 minutes after the container base image changed NTP behavior. We added a drift probe that logs scheduled-vs-actual start times to the ops schema. Root cause is confirmed; remediation ships next sprint. Anyone reproducing the drift report should query the probe table via the connection string below.

primary connection of tajeg-tajop = postgresql://julax_svc:DI@db-e7f3.kelvidyn.corp:5432/rusdor

## 2.8.1 — Signing key rotation

The signing key for the Larkspell seat-map renderer was rotated this release as part of scheduled credential hygiene; the previous key is now revoked. Older builds verified against the retired key will fail checks after this date, which is expected. When assisting patrons or venue staff, verify current bundles against the new key below.

deploy key for kajof-yawif: bky9_fvxrpdHPq

## Deployment

Batchwise is a recipe-scaling calculator with no authentication tier; all inputs are treated as untrusted. Scaling math runs server-side with strict bounds checking on quantities and unit conversions, and the parser rejects any payload over the size ceiling before evaluation. The container runs as a non-root user with a read-only filesystem. For review purposes, the production deployment applies the following configuration values.

config for tagep-yajef:
ulawyn:
  log_level: error
  metrics_host: metrics.ulawyn.lumiclabs.internal
  pin: 0564
  pool_size: 32

**TICKET: Expired credentials blocking GC-pause dashboards — Matchwright**

The Matchwright matching service has been showing 800ms+ garbage-collection pauses during peak pairing windows, but our profiling agent stopped reporting last Friday because its credentials lapsed. New team members: this is why the pause graphs in Glimview are flat, not because the problem resolved. To restore telemetry, re-authenticate the agent against the internal Glimview ingest API using the key below.

API key for fahip-kahip: zpat23_XiJGUHz5xfaAtaIqUkus0rh